研究概览

简要总结

The broad objective of this study is to test the association between hyperoxia exposure after resuscitation from cardiac arrest and outcome. Our overarching hypothesis is that hyperoxia after ROSC is associated with increased oxidative stress and worsened neurological and cognitive outcomes.

详细描述

Specific Aim 1: Test if the degree and duration of hyperoxia following ROSC from cardiac arrest is associated with the degree of in vivo oxidative stress during the post-resuscitation phase of therapy.

Approach: We will conduct a multicenter prospective observational study of adult patients resuscitated from cardiac arrest. We will record data pertaining to oxygenation parameters and other factors and measure biomarkers of oxidative stress (isoprostanes and isofurans) in the plasma at 0 and 6 hours after ROSC using gas chromatography negative ion chemical ionization mass spectrometry. We will determine the exposure to post-ROSC hyperoxia by calculating the time-weighted average PaO2 and SaO2 for the post-resuscitation phase of therapy, and will test the association with plasma isoprostane and isofuran levels.

Specific Aim 2: Test if the degree and duration of hyperoxia following ROSC from cardiac arrest is associated with the degree of neurological disability at hospital discharge.

Approach: In the study described above, we will determine the Modified Rankin Scale at hospital discharge. We will perform multivariable analyses adjusted for numerous covariates known to be associated with outcome in post-cardiac arrest patients to determine if post-ROSC hyperoxia exposure is independently associated with neurological disability.

Specific Aim 3: Test if the degree and duration of hyperoxia following ROSC from cardiac arrest is associated with neuropsychological outcomes among survivors at 180 days.

入排标准

年龄范围
18 Years 至 —(Adult, Older Adult)
性别
All
接受健康志愿者

入选标准

  • Age >17 years
  • Cardiac arrest
  • Return of spontaneous circulation
  • Not following commands immediately after ROSC
  • Endotracheal intubation
  • Clinician intent to treat with therapeutic hypothermia (or absence of clinician intent to withhold therapeutic hypothermia)

排除标准

  • Presumed etiology of arrest is trauma
  • Presumed etiology of arrest is hemorrhage
  • Presumed etiology of arrest is sepsis
  • Permanent resident of nursing home or other long-term care facility
  • Any other condition, that in the opinion of the investigator, would preclude the subject from being a suitable candidate, e.g. end stage chronic illness with no reasonable expectation of survival to hospital discharge
